(Dan Tri) - The story of little Sol (Doan Trang's daughter) protecting her classmates from being bullied inspired an anti-child violence MV.
Baby Sol (real name Angeline, born in 2014) is the daughter of singer Doan Trang and her Swedish husband. Although only 10 years old, she is said to be smart and fluent in 3 languages. On her personal page, Doan Trang often shares videos about how she raises her children.
During a media conference on November 25, Doan Trang recounted the story of her daughter’s first day of school in a multinational classroom in Singapore four years ago. At that time, little Sol witnessed a boy bullying a girl and she stepped in to stop him, asking him to stop.
The mother of the bullied girl was deeply moved. Doan Trang herself also felt proud of her daughter.

In particular, this story inspired director Nau Pham and the crew to make the MV "Lover", after hearing Sol share it during a training session on anti-violence against women held in October in Hanoi.
The MV not only recreates the inspiring story of little Sol, but also conveys the message of bravely standing up to help, fighting against violence and eliminating it with empathy and love.
Lover is the song that won first prize in the first poetry and song writing contest on gender equality organized by the United Nations Entity for Gender Equality and the Empowerment of Women (UN Women) in Vietnam in 2023.
In addition to this song, 4 other songs including Freedom, Boys and Girls, Chu lat dat, Khuc ca phat gian (Gender Equality Song) also had MVs made, responding to the International Day for the Elimination of Violence against Women on November 25.
The MVs also feature many artists such as the couple Ho Ngoc Ha - Kim Ly, singer Doan Trang, actress Kathy Uyen, runner-up - MC Thuy Van...
